The semifinal line-up for the 2026 National Division One Playoffs has been confirmed following the conclusion of the group stage at the Port Loko Mini Stadium.
Marampa Stars, Waterloo FC, Great Scarcies FC, and Western United FC have secured places in the last four after a series of competitive fixtures, setting up decisive encounters that will determine which teams earn promotion to the 2026/27 Sierra Leone Premier League.
Waterloo FC emerged as one of the early pace-setters in the group stage, collecting six points from its opening two matches with victories over Great Scarcies and AI Kallon. Marampa Stars, Great Scarcies, and Western United also advanced after navigating a competitive group phase that featured ten clubs divided into two pools of five.
The semifinal matches carry significant importance, as victory will guarantee automatic promotion to the country’s top-flight league while also securing a place in the playoff final, where the National Division One championship title will be contested.
